Development and quantitative evaluation of leading and lagging metrics of emergency planning and response element for sustainable process safety performance
The process industries are encountering challenges in terms of process disasters; therefore, safety performance has become a focal spot for forthcoming research. Since the process safety management (PSM) has ignored the insight behavior of performance indicators along with their associated metrics....
